The 70’s was the absolute last gasp for the dying medium known as commercial radio.

It was the last time you could tune in to a radio station where the programming was curated by a human being rather than programmed by charts and graphs and a computer.

It was the last time a DJ had a couple of open slots every hour where they could pick what they wanted and were allowed to spin a record just to see if it caught on with the listeners.

It was the last time a song which exceeded a four minute and twenty five second time limit could still find a home on the airwaves.

It was still a time before the sleazy likes of Rupert Murdoch and Clear Channel.

That’s what I miss about the 70’s.
